Caregiver Skills or Functional Resume Example

Updated on: April 5, 2022

A caregiver skills-based or functional resume is useful for caregivers who:

  • Have little or no experience
  • Possess a diverse background and want to organize all relevant information into a logical format
  • Are changing their career path.

It emphasizes caregiving skills and capabilities rather than relevant work experience.

Caregiver Skills can be established through different means such as caregiving courses, volunteer or summer work, and personal experiences.

You should do your best to match your transferable skills to the caregiver position or employer.

While one might argue why they can not be simply put on a piece of paper, it is essential that an employer receives some kind of structure that depicts all these attributes.

A caregiver skills resume should be short, to the point, and relevant to the job description provided by the employer in the advertisement.

Sample Skills Resume for Caregiver Position

MARIA ALEXANDER
8 Heather Road
Newark, DE 70122
(000) 000-0999
Email


CAREGIVER
I offer compassion and caregiving skills to assist residents to live a dignified life.

KEY QUALIFICATIONS

  • 2+ years’ hands-on experience in the personal care arena
  • Highly skilled in providing resident care following the facility’s protocols
  • Well versed in designing and implementing activities to keep the residents
  • Proficient in preparing food based on each resident’s individual needs
  • CPR and first aid Certified
  • Computer: MS Office Applications
  • Bilingual: Spanish and English

 PROFESSIONAL SKILLS

  • Safe patient handling
  • Emergency responding
  • Time management
  • Agile and empathetic
  • Sanitation standards
  • Communication

P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E

Personal Care Attendant
Newark Residents – Newark, DE 
2014 – 2016

  • Provided care to multicultural patients under the facility’s laws and protocols
  • Took and recorded vital signs
  • Performed first aid and emergency response procedures when necessary
  • Prepared and served meals
  • Assisted residents with bathing, changing, and toileting
  • Performed light housekeeping tasks including cleaning and laundry
  • Assisted residents by involving them in daily activities
  • Accompanied residents to and from the facility for appointments and other activities

EDUCATION
High School Diploma
CITY SCHOOL, Newark, DE – 2005
